As with the city of New York itself, the idea of patchwork is prevalent. A multitude of textures, techniques, crafts and stories. From dresses echoing the timeless and labor-intensive qualities of the American quilt to limited-edition knits that assemble and repurpose archive yarns into textural collages. Each piece a wearable luxury built to last, where every stitch counts and nothing is wasted. The natural worn permanence of the workwear inspiration is complemented by the introduction of versatile leather pieces such as a classic white shirt transformed into skived fine nappa and matching shorts. And a full range of Made In Italy bags and footwear which embrace contrasting materials – celebrating the juxtaposition of the raw and the refined, grain against canvas, texture and tonality, bursts of cobalt blue bringing verve and vibrancy to the season’s neutral palette. The bags themselves are built around the values and versatility of the Lafayette 148 woman’s daily life. The leather cage bag with its removeable and interchangeable canvas interior re-enforcing that in this collection the construction and interior are as meaningful as the outer surface. Ultimately, the collection is a holistic expression of femininity, where style is imbued with confidence, purpose with romanticism, heritage with modernity. And a wardrobe of effortless garments embedded with functionality, intricately assembled details, and a commitment to sustainable practice. Created and crafted with a lightness of touch.
